The short version

Winneconne is home to 2,511 people in Wisconsin. At a median age of 43.8, this is an older place than the country as a whole. 1% of people here were born outside the United States. Owners hold 75% of the housing stock. Home values have more than doubled since 2000, reaching $218,100. Median rent is $852 a month.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Winneconne, Wisconsin?

Winneconne, Wisconsin has about 2,511 residents according to the 2024 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in Winneconne, Wisconsin?

The typical household in Winneconne, Wisconsin earns about $82,411 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Winneconne, Wisconsin expensive?

In Winneconne, Wisconsin, the median home is worth about $218,100, and the typical rent is about $852 a month.

How educated are people in Winneconne, Wisconsin?

About 34.4% of adults age 25 and over in Winneconne, Wisconsin h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Winneconne, Wisconsin?

About 5.4% of people in Winneconne, Wisconsin live below the federal poverty line.

Has Winneconne, Wisconsin grown since 1990?

Yes, Winneconne, Wisconsin has grown since 1990. The population has added about 452 residents, a change of about 22 percent over that period.
